Support for Case Managers

Borders Occupational Therapy has extensive experience working alongside case managers to support clients in achieving their maximum functional potential following injury or illness.

We offer comprehensive initial assessments and detailed reports, providing bespoke recommendations tailored to each client's individual needs and goals. Recommendations may include targeted occupational therapy intervention, equipment provision, environmental adaptations, support with regaining structure and routine, or longer-term rehabilitation programmes. We are able to assess client’s with a range of presenting conditions including orthopaedic trauma and brain injury.

Fiona brings a wealth of medico-legal experience and regularly prepares care and occupational therapy expert witness reports for the court. This specialist expertise provides a strong understanding of the complex needs often experienced following life-changing injuries, enabling informed recommendations that support recovery, independence, and quality of life.

We recognise that navigating rehabilitation and care needs following a significant injury can be challenging. Our aim is to work collaboratively with clients, families, case managers, and the wider multidisciplinary team to ensure that rehabilitation is meaningful, goal-focused, and centred on the individual's needs. Borders Occupational Therapy are able to accept referrals within the Scottish Borders and surrounding areas.
